A lampshade has a height of 12cm and upper and lower diameters of 10cm and 20cm A)what area of material is required to cover that curved surface of the frustum B)what is the volume of the frustum (Give both answers in terms of pie)

Answers

Answer:

[tex](a)\ Area = 195\pi[/tex]

[tex](b)\ Volume = 700\pi[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

[tex]h = 12[/tex]

[tex]d_1 = 10[/tex] --- lower diameter

[tex]d_2 = 20[/tex] --- upper diameter

Solving (a): The curved surface area

This is calculated as:

[tex]Area = \pi l(r_1 + r_2)[/tex]

Where

[tex]r_1 = 0.5 * d_1 = 0.5 * 10 = 5[/tex] --- lower radius

[tex]r_2 = 0.5 * d_2 = 0.5 * 20 = 10[/tex] --- upper radius

And

[tex]l = \sqrt{h^2 + (r_1 - r_2)^2[/tex] ---- l represents the slant height of the frustrum

[tex]l = \sqrt{12^2 + (5 - 10)^2[/tex]

[tex]l = \sqrt{12^2 + (-5)^2[/tex]

[tex]l = \sqrt{144 + 25[/tex]

[tex]l = \sqrt{169[/tex]

[tex]l = 13[/tex]

So, we have:

[tex]Area = \pi l(r_1 + r_2)[/tex]

[tex]Area = \pi * 13(5 + 10)[/tex]

[tex]Area = \pi * 13(15)[/tex]

[tex]Area = 195\pi[/tex]

Solving (b): The volume

This is calculated as:

[tex]Volume = \frac{1}{3}\pi * h * (r_1^2 + r_2^2 + (r_1 * r_2))[/tex]

This gives:

[tex]Volume = \frac{1}{3}\pi * 12 * (5^2 + 10^2 + (5 * 10))[/tex]

[tex]Volume = \frac{1}{3}\pi * 12 * (25 + 100 + (50))[/tex]

[tex]Volume = \frac{1}{3}\pi * 12 * (175)[/tex]

[tex]Volume = \pi *4 * 175[/tex]

[tex]Volume = 700\pi[/tex]

Two similar cylinders have radii of 15 inches and 6 inches. What is the ratio of the surface area of the small cylinder to the surface area of the large cylinder.

Answers

Answer:

4:25

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that,

r₁ = 15 inches, r₂ = 6 inches

The area of the cylinder is given by :

[tex]A=2\pi rh+2\pi r^2[/tex]

The ratio of surface areas of two cylinders,

[tex]\dfrac{S_2}{S_1}=\dfrac{2\pi r_2h_2+2\pi r_2^2}{2\pi r_1h_1+2\pi r_1^2}\\\\\dfrac{S_2}{S_1}=(\dfrac{r_2}{r_1})^2\\\\=\dfrac{6}{15}^2\\\\=\dfrac{4}{25}[/tex]

Hence, the required ratio is 4:25.

The reflection of point P=(-1,6) across the x-axis is the point (-1,-6).

What is reflection?

In mathematics, reflection is a transformation that flips a shape, point, or object over a line, plane, or point. Reflection is also known as flipping, mirroring, or symmetry.

In two-dimensional geometry, the most common type of reflection is a mirror reflection, which involves flipping a shape or point over a line (known as the line of reflection) to create a mirror image. The line of reflection acts as a mirror, and the shape or point is reflected in the mirror as if it were a real reflection.

To find the reflection of the point P=(-1,6) across the x-axis, we can use the following formula:

Rx-axis(P) = (x, -y)

where x is the x-coordinate of P, and y is the y-coordinate of P.

In this case, the x-coordinate of P is -1, and the y-coordinate of P is 6. Therefore, the reflection of P across the x-axis, Rx-axis(P), is:

Rx-axis(P) = (-1, -6)

So the reflection of point P=(-1,6) across the x-axis is the point (-1,-6).
